Tailhook Posted October 25, 2018 Share Posted October 25, 2018 So I took an IR up the butt and resulted in complete loss off electrical and power. Most of the enemy airfield was cleared so I glided back to dead-stick land it with hopes of being able to wait for my team to capture it and repair. I managed to belly land and waited for the capture (15 minutes). Repair started and the moment it dropped my jet to the ground I exploded. I assume this might be an issue with every aircraft (or maybe just non-FC3) but I haven't experimented. It would be nice if the repair would auto extend the gear during repairs so this type of thing won't be a problem again. https://clips.twitch.tv/BloodyFamousMomItsBoshyTime P.S.- I've also noticed EVERY single time the electrical gets shot out, the engines cut off after 10 seconds too. Is that realistic with the Hornet? Cause I'd like to still be able to RTB without any electrical like I frequently can do with the Eagle.
